A Novel Signature Histogram Based Indexing For CBIR System

Abstract: Content Based Image Retrieval (CBIR) is a technique used for retrieving similar images for given input image from an image database. CBIR aims to retrieve the images based on the content of a given image rather than textual information of a file name. CBIR uses the various features such as color, texture, shape etc.The shape is independent of transformations like scaling, translation, rotation and flip. A good shape representation method retrieve similar images irrespective of the transformation performed on a shape. The known shape representation called β€œcentroid contour distance (CCD) signature” is invariant to translation, scale but not to rotation and flip. The CCD signature quantize into signature histogram which is invariance to rotation and flip. It has a drawback namely number of false positives will increase i.e. many different shapes can have a β€œsimilar signature histogram”. This problem can be solved with augmented signature histogram with information present at the boundary of object. Images are presented to a user calculating Euclidian distance matching with every shape descriptor is a computational expensive problem. With large database this process may take minutes, hours. So to reduce the computational requirement, the images are indexed based on Color, Medial Axis, Area, Eccentricity, and Euler number.These indexing parameters are bias. To overcome this problem the static parameter such as mean was calculated from the signature histogram. Based on mean value images are indexed. This reduces the search space in retrieval process.
